Title:A map shewing the elevation of the monuments on the First, Third, Fifth, Eighth & Tenth Avenues in the city of New York above a medium between high & low tide water...
Item Type:Maps
Date:1817
Call Number NS11 M15.2.9

Creator Information (Person)

creator: Randel, John, jr.

Creator Information (Organization)

Sorry, no records in this category

Notes

General_note: "taken with a sector of 54 inches Radius..." shows full extent of avenues in profile
Extent: 1 manuscript map on 3 separate sheets
Added_date: 1820
Dimensions: 58 x 268 cm. (total)
Local_note: accompanied by: 3872-A: 7 pp. of calculations (unbound, numbered pts. 1-7) on each of the five avenues, concluding with the statement, "the preceding elevations above medium tide is correct for map subject to a correction of curvature / 26 Decr 1820 / J.R.jr."
Medium: black ink, black pencil and color wash on paper
